207 changes: 207 additions & 0 deletions apps/desktop/src/main/crypto/recovery.test.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,207 @@
import * as bip39 from 'bip39'
import sodium from 'libsodium-wrappers-sumo'
import { beforeAll, describe, expect, it } from 'vitest'

import { ARGON2_PARAMS } from '@memry/contracts/crypto'

import { deriveMasterKey } from './keys'
import {
generateRecoveryPhrase,
phraseToSeed,
rec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ase,
validateKeyVerifier,
validateRecoveryPhrase
} from './recovery'

beforeAll(async () => {
await sodium.ready
})

const englishWordSet = new Set(bip39.wordlists.english)

const makeSaltBytesAndB64 = (): { bytes: Uint8Array; b64: string } => {
const bytes = sodium.randombytes_buf(ARGON2_PARAMS.SALT_LENGTH)
return { bytes, b64: sodium.to_base64(bytes, sodium.base64_variants.ORIGINAL) }
}

describe('generateRecoveryPhrase', () => {
it('returns a 24-word BIP-39 phrase whose words are all in the English wordlist', async () => {
// #given a freshly generated recovery phrase
const result =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#when splitting the phrase into words
const words = result.phrase.split(' ')

// #then it has 24 words, each in the BIP-39 English wordlist
expect(words).toHaveLength(24)
for (const word of words) {
expect(englishWordSet.has(word)).toBe(true)
}
})

it('produces a phrase that passes BIP-39 checksum validation', async () => {
// #given a freshly generated recovery phrase
const result =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#then BIP-39 checksum validation accepts it
expect(bip39.validateMnemonic(result.phrase)).toBe(true)
})

it('returns a 64-byte seed bound to the phrase', async () => {
// #given a freshly generated recovery phrase
const result =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#when the seed is regenerated from the same phrase
const seedAgain = await phraseToSeed(result.phrase)

// #then the seed is 64 bytes and matches the deterministic derivation
expect(result.seed).toBeInstanceOf(Uint8Array)
expect(result.seed).toHaveLength(64)
expect(seedAgain).toEqual(result.seed)
})

it('produces unique phrases on repeated calls', async () => {
// #given two freshly generated recovery phrases
const a =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const b =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#then they differ (256-bit entropy — collision probability is negligible)
expect(a.phrase).not.toBe(b.phrase)
})
})

describe('validateRecoveryPhrase', () => {
it('accepts a valid generated phrase', async () => {
// #given a freshly generated recovery phrase
const { phrase }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#then validation accepts it
expect(validateRecoveryPhrase(phrase)).toBe(true)
})

it('rejects a phrase with a corrupted checksum word', async () => {
// #given a generated phrase whose final (checksum) word is swapped for a different valid word
const { phrase }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const words = phrase.split(' ')
const lastWord = words[words.length - 1]
const replacement = lastWord === 'abandon' ? 'ability' : 'abandon'
words[words.length - 1] = replacement

// #then validation rejects the tampered phrase (checksum mismatch)
expect(validateRecoveryPhrase(words.join(' '))).toBe(false)
})

it('rejects a phrase containing a word outside the BIP-39 wordlist', async () => {
// #given a generated phrase with a non-wordlist token spliced in
const { phrase }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const words = phrase.split(' ')
words[0] = 'notarealbip39word'

// #then validation rejects the phrase
expect(validateRecoveryPhrase(words.join(' '))).toBe(false)
})

it('rejects an empty string', () => {
// #given an empty phrase
// #then validation rejects it
expect(validateRecoveryPhrase('')).toBe(false)
})
})

describe('phraseToSeed', () => {
it('is deterministic — same phrase always derives the same seed', async () => {
// #given the same phrase
const { phrase }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#when deriving twice
const a = await phraseToSeed(phrase)
const b = await phraseToSeed(phrase)

// #then the seeds match exactly
expect(a).toEqual(b)
expect(a).toHaveLength(64)
})

it('produces different seeds for different phrases', async () => {
// #given two different phrases
const first =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const second = await generateRecoveryPhrase()

// #when deriving seeds
const seedA = await phraseToSeed(first.phrase)
const seedB = await phraseToSeed(second.phrase)

// #then the seeds differ
expect(seedA).not.toEqual(seedB)
})
})

describe('rec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ase', () => {
it('round-trips: derive from generated seed → recover from phrase → keys match', async () => {
// #given a recovery phrase, its seed, and a salt
const { phrase, seed }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const salt = makeSaltBytesAndB64()

// #when deriving the master key directly and via recovery
const direct = await deriveMasterKey(seed, salt.bytes)
const recovered = await rec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ase(phrase, salt.b64)

// #then both paths produce the same master key, salt, and verifier
expect(recovered.masterKey).toEqual(direct.masterKey)
expect(recovered.kdfSalt).toBe(direct.kdfSalt)
expect(recovered.keyVerifier).toBe(direct.keyVerifier)
})

it('produces different master keys for different salts even with the same phrase', async () => {
// #given one phrase and two distinct salts
const { phrase }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const saltA = makeSaltBytesAndB64()
const saltB = makeSaltBytesAndB64()

// #when recovering with each salt
const recoveredA = await rec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ase(phrase, saltA.b64)
const recoveredB = await rec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ase(phrase, saltB.b64)

// #then the master keys differ — salt is mixed into the KDF
expect(recoveredA.masterKey).not.toEqual(recoveredB.masterKey)
})
})

describe('validateKeyVerifier', () => {
it('returns true when both verifiers are byte-equal', async () => {
// #given a verifier derived from a recovered master key
const { phrase } =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const salt = makeSaltBytesAndB64()
const recovered = await rec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ase(phrase, salt.b64)

// #then comparison against itself succeeds
expect(validateKeyVerifier(recovered.keyVerifier, recovered.keyVerifier)).toBe(true)
})

it('returns false when the derived verifier differs from the server verifier', async () => {
// #given two phrases producing different verifiers under the same salt
const salt = makeSaltBytesAndB64()
const a =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const b = await generateRecoveryPhrase()
const recoveredA = await rec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ase(a.phrase, salt.b64)
const recoveredB = await recoverMasterKeyFromPhrase(b.phrase, salt.b64)

// #then the verifiers don't match
expect(validateKeyVerifier(recoveredA.keyVerifier, recoveredB.keyVerifier)).toBe(false)
})

it('returns false when the two verifiers have different lengths', () => {
// #given verifiers of differing lengths
// #then comparison short-circuits to false (length leak is acceptable for fixed-size keys)
expect(validateKeyVerifier('short', 'considerably-longer-string')).toBe(false)
})

it('returns false when verifiers differ by a single byte at the same length', () => {
// #given two equal-length verifiers differing in one character
const a = 'aaaaaaaa'
const b = 'aaaaaaab'

// #then comparison rejects
expect(validateKeyVerifier(a, b)).toBe(false)
})
})
